Transnational migrant communities and Mexican migration to the US

TL;DR: In this article, the authors explore the variability of US-Mexico migration, positioning the emerging discourse on transnational migration within a migration systems approach Looking at factors in the social and economic structures of Mexico and the US, they evaluate the prevalence of Transnational migration patterns among Mexican migrants in conjunction with past patterns of temporary and permanent migration.

The free-market city: Latin American urbanization in the years of the neoliberal experiment

TL;DR: The authors examined the evolution of Latin American cities in the last two decades of the twentieth century and in the first years of the twenty-first on the basis of comparable data from six countries comprising over 80 percent of the region's population.
